On Monday I by chance found Ladbrokes had given me 20 free spins on Jonny Specter worth 4.
Much to my surprise I got the free-spins & won 10!
I then played a few spins with my own money - no problem.

Now here's the spooky thing; I wanted to have a few more goes later that evening - but the game wouldn't load.
I've tried it again every day since (including today) and it's the same thing - the 'Refreshing State' bar gets half way across & then everything freezes (see screenshot). I've left it for over 10 minutes - but nothing happened.

I've had no problems loading any other games at Ladbrokes, and Jonny loads up OK at 32Red on the same computer...

Anyone else having this weird experiance...? :confused:

Have you tried going into the casino folder\global\gameregistry and deleting the entry for the game?
It should update next time you load the casino and hopefully work ok.
